From ea6c5ce90d6009f4b883b1003fec16521b5c5756 Mon Sep 17 00:00:00 2001 From: Alan Modra Date: Thu, 10 Feb 2011 08:04:22 +0000 Subject: [PATCH] * ld-scripts/defined.exp: Don't run defined5 for AOUT. * ld-scripts/defined5.s: Use .text for "defined" section. * ld-scripts/defined5.t: Adjust. --- ld/testsuite/ChangeLog | 4 ++++ ld/testsuite/ld-scripts/defined.exp | 4 +++- ld/testsuite/ld-scripts/defined5.s | 2 +- ld/testsuite/ld-scripts/defined5.t | 2 +- 4 files changed, 9 insertions(+), 3 deletions(-) diff --git a/ld/testsuite/ChangeLog b/ld/testsuite/ChangeLog index 9c36f6d..3796f17 100644 --- a/ld/testsuite/ChangeLog +++ b/ld/testsuite/ChangeLog @@ -1,5 +1,9 @@ 2011-02-10 Alan Modra + * ld-scripts/defined.exp: Don't run defined5 for AOUT. + * ld-scripts/defined5.s: Use .text for "defined" section. + * ld-scripts/defined5.t: Adjust. + * ld-gc/start.d: Exclude frv-*-linux*. * ld-misc/defsym1.d: Likewise. diff --git a/ld/testsuite/ld-scripts/defined.exp b/ld/testsuite/ld-scripts/defined.exp index 10f14da..bfee102 100644 --- a/ld/testsuite/ld-scripts/defined.exp +++ b/ld/testsuite/ld-scripts/defined.exp @@ -67,5 +67,7 @@ set prms_id 0 run_dump_test "defined2" run_dump_test "defined3" run_dump_test "defined4" -run_dump_test "defined5" +if ![is_aout_format] { + run_dump_test "defined5" +} set LDFLAGS "$saved_LDFLAGS" diff --git a/ld/testsuite/ld-scripts/defined5.s b/ld/testsuite/ld-scripts/defined5.s index 592e54c..9dd58d6 100644 --- a/ld/testsuite/ld-scripts/defined5.s +++ b/ld/testsuite/ld-scripts/defined5.s @@ -1,6 +1,6 @@ .globl defined .data .byte 0 - .section .data.cacheline_aligned + .text defined: .byte 0 diff --git a/ld/testsuite/ld-scripts/defined5.t b/ld/testsuite/ld-scripts/defined5.t index 189da6b..04daf66 100644 --- a/ld/testsuite/ld-scripts/defined5.t +++ b/ld/testsuite/ld-scripts/defined5.t @@ -1,6 +1,6 @@ defined = addr1; SECTIONS { - .data.cacheline_aligned : { *(.data.cacheline_aligned) } + .text : { *(.text) } . = ALIGN (0x1000); .data : { *(.data) } addr1 = ADDR (.data); -- 2.7.4